Here's a detailed look at the 2016 Land Rover Discovery Sport 2.0 TD4 SE Tech Auto 4WD—a model that blends rugged capability with premium comfort and tech:
???? Key Specifications
• Engine: 2.0L TD4 Ingenium Diesel
• Power Output: 180 PS (approx. 178 bhp)
• Transmission: 9-speed automatic
• Drivetrain: Four-wheel drive (4WD)
• Fuel Type: Diesel
• Emissions Standard: Euro 6 (with stop/start system)
Performance & Efficiency
• 0–60 mph: ~8.9 seconds
• Top Speed: ~117 mph
• Fuel Economy: Around 53.3 mpg (combined, official figures)
• CO? Emissions: ~139 g/km
• Towing Capacity: Up to 2,200 kg (braked)

The 2016 Land Rover Discovery Sport TD4 SE Tech delivers a driving experience that's confident, composed, and surprisingly refined for a rugged SUV. Here's how it stacks up behind the wheel:
On-Road Comfort
• Smooth Gear Changes: The 9-speed automatic transmission is well-calibrated, offering seamless shifts whether you're cruising or overtaking.
• Ride Quality: It's tuned more for comfort than sportiness. You'll feel cushioned over bumps and potholes, though sharper imperfections can occasionally make their presence known.
• Cabin Quietness: Diesel clatter is well-muted, especially at cruising speeds. Wind and road noise are minimal, giving it a premium feel.
Off-Road Capability
• True 4WD: With Land Rover's Terrain Response system, it adapts to mud, snow, gravel, and more. It's not just for show—it can genuinely handle rough terrain.
• Hill Descent Control: Makes steep declines feel controlled and safe, even for less experienced drivers.
• Ground Clearance: Offers enough height to clear obstacles without drama.
Handling & Dynamics
• Steering: Light and accurate, ideal for city driving and parking. It firms up nicely at higher speeds for motorway stability.
• Body Control: There's some lean in corners, but it's predictable and never feels sloppy.
• Braking: Strong and progressive, with good pedal feel.
